What is the cheapest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port flight route?

Data is based on round-trip flight searches on KAYAK over the past month.

The cheapest return flight from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port costs $96 on the route between Houston George Bush Intcntl Airport (IAH) and New York LaGuardia Airport (LGA). Over the past month, this route was, on average, 29% cheaper than other Houston-New York LaGuardia Airport routes. It is also the most popular route.

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

When flying from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port, you should consider leaving on a Tuesday and avoid Sundays if you are looking for the best rates. For your return to Houston, you’ll find the best rates on Thursdays and the most expensive ones on Sundays.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port is February, where tickets cost $187 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and June,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$352 and $318 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port, you should book around 3 weeks before departure, which saves you about 36%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 9 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Houston to New York LaGuardia Airport?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to New York LaGuardia Airport with an airline and back to Houston with another airline.
